Good morning. It is best to know how many people you will have and their ages. Generally, we recommend staying closer to Cruz Bay for first timers. That is where the majority of the restaurants are. Cruz Bay is a great small port town for walking and has a late night scene.

Coral Bay is more rural and we do have herds of donkeys, goats, and sheep. Coral Bay restaurants generally close by 8PM. Salty Mongoose might stay open until 9PM some nights.
